2,000 kids take part in sport
carnival
CHANDIGARH,
April 28 It was carnival sport time at the St
John's High School, Sector 26, where nearly 2,000
students of 31 schools of city and its periphery
participated. The carnival sport was part of the two-day
meet organised by Tetra Pak.
Amritsar boys beat Delhi
CHANDIGARH,
April 28 Amritsar beat Delhi by five wickets in an
under-14 cricket tournament in the PCA Stadium at SAS
Nagar today. In another match of the day, Jalandhar
defeated Patiala by 86 runs.
Section 144 imposed
CHANDIGARH,
April 28 To provide security for the proposed
meeting of the Rashtriya Sikh Sangat, the Sub Divisional
Magistrate, South, Mr Ashish Kundra, has imposed a ban on
the assembly of five or more persons , raising slogans,
making speeches, sitting in dharna, carrying of lathis
and weapons within 200 metres from boundary wall of the
venue of the meeting.
Sector 43 ISBT opens today
CHANDIGARH,
April 28 The second Inter-State Bus Terminus in
Sector 43 will be formally inaugurated by the UT
Administrator, Lieut-Gen J.F.R. Jacob (retd), at 10.30 am
tomorrow. He will flag off a bus to officially make the
ISBT functional.
